About Climate Change Law in Phnom Penh, Cambodia

Climate Change Law in Phnom Penh, Cambodia, refers to all legal measures and policies that the government and institutions have enacted to address climate change. The country's capital has implemented regulations and commitments to reduce greenhouse gas emissions, promote sustainable development, and protect communities from the effects of climate change. These laws cover a variety of sectors, including energy, forestry, transportation, waste management, and agriculture, aiming to balance economic growth with environmental protection.

Local Laws Overview

Cambodia has taken several legal steps to address climate change, many of which affect Phnom Penh directly. The country is a member of the United Nations Framework Convention on Climate Change (UNFCCC) and a signatory to the Paris Agreement. Locally, the Law on Environmental Protection and Natural Resource Management forms the foundation for environmental governance. Additionally, sub-decrees on Environmental Impact Assessment (EIA) procedures and sector-specific regulations set standards for managing waste, water quality, air pollution, and land use.

The Ministry of Environment is the main governmental body enforcing climate and environmental laws. Local regulations in Phnom Penh may also involve collaboration between city authorities and national government ministries, especially regarding urban planning, public infrastructure, and transportation emissions.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is Climate Change Law?

Climate Change Law refers to legal frameworks, statutes, and regulations designed to reduce greenhouse gas emissions, adapt to climate risks, and support sustainable development goals.

Are there specific climate change laws in Phnom Penh?

There is no single comprehensive climate change law, but a combination of national laws, city ordinances, and sectoral policies that govern climate-related issues in Phnom Penh.

Who enforces Climate Change Law in Phnom Penh?

The Ministry of Environment oversees enforcement, with local authorities administering specific projects and regulations within the city.

Do businesses need to comply with Environmental Impact Assessments?

Yes, most development projects of a certain size or environmental risk require an Environmental Impact Assessment before proceeding.

How does the Paris Agreement affect local laws?

Cambodia's obligations under the Paris Agreement influence national policy and laws. This means Phnom Penh authorities are required to implement measures that help meet national targets for emission reduction and climate resilience.

Can individuals bring legal action in cases of environmental harm?

Yes, individuals or communities affected by environmental harm can seek legal remedy through administrative complaints or, in some cases, through the courts.

How does Climate Change Law affect land use in Phnom Penh?

Regulations may limit or restrict land development in environmentally sensitive areas, and require mitigation measures to minimize climate-related risks such as flooding or pollution.

Are there incentives for adopting renewable energy?

The government has promoted investment in renewable energy, and incentives may be available through grants, tax benefits, or streamlined permitting processes.

What penalties exist for violating climate or environmental laws?

Penalties can include fines, suspension of business licenses, orders for environmental restoration, or even criminal prosecution in severe cases.
